Where to look
Tamil grocery stores cluster where the community lives - Scarborough, Markham, Ajax, and pockets of Mississauga and Brampton. What a good Tamil grocer carries
- Fresh curry leaves, drumsticks, snake gourd, and other South Indian vegetables
- A full spice wall - roasted curry powders, sambar and rasam mixes, whole spices
- Dried fish, jaggery, palm sugar, and regional rice varieties
- Fresh sweets and short-eats counters, especially near festival season
Tips for newcomers
Many stores restock produce mid-week, so shop then for the freshest vegetables. Prices on staples like rice, oil, and lentils vary between shops - it is worth comparing two or three near you. Around Deepavali, Thai Pongal, and Tamil New Year, the bigger stores get busy fast, so go early.
